§1The Birth of a Digital Behemoth 🚀

Imagine a world before endless feeds and algorithmic curation, where the internet was still finding its voice. Enter Reddit, co-founded by Steve Huffman and Alexis Ohanian (alongside Aaron Swartz, who departed early on) in June 2005. Born from the Y Combinator incubator, their vision was simple yet revolutionary: a platform where users, not editors, determined what was important. It was designed as a social news aggregation, content rating, and discussion website. Initially, it was a lean operation, using Lisp before a pivotal switch to Python in 2006, a move that allowed for greater scalability and flexibility. From its humble beginnings, Reddit quickly became a hub for early internet adopters, fostering a unique culture that would define its trajectory for decades. It was acquired by Condé Nast in 2006, a move that provided resources but also sparked debates about corporate influence versus community autonomy. 💡

§2How the Hive Mind Works: Subreddits & Upvotes ⬆️⬇️

At its core, Reddit is organized into thousands of user-created communities called subreddits, each dedicated to a specific topic. Think of it as a city with countless neighborhoods: r/science for scientific breakthroughs, r/aww for adorable animals, r/wallstreetbets for chaotic financial speculation, and everything in between. Users submit posts—links, text, images, videos—to these subreddits. The magic happens with the upvote and downvote system: content that resonates with the community rises to the top, while irrelevant or unpopular content sinks. This democratic mechanism ensures that the most engaging and relevant discussions are prominently displayed, creating a dynamic, ever-changing 'front page' tailored to individual interests. The karma system, a numerical representation of a user's contributions, adds a gamified layer, encouraging positive engagement and discouraging spam. It's a self-regulating ecosystem, albeit one prone to its own unique brand of internet drama. 🎭

§4The Good, The Bad, and The Controversial ⚖️

Like any massive online platform, Reddit is a double-edged sword. On one hand, it fosters incredible communities, provides support networks, and facilitates the spread of information and knowledge. The AMA (Ask Me Anything) sessions, where celebrities, scientists, and even presidents answer user questions, have become a staple of internet culture. On the other hand, Reddit has grappled with significant challenges, including issues of moderation, hate speech, and the spread of misinformation. The platform's commitment to free speech has often clashed with the need to maintain a safe and inclusive environment, leading to high-profile bans of controversial subreddits and ongoing debates about content policy. The tension between top-down moderation and community self-governance remains a defining characteristic of Reddit's evolving identity. It’s a constant tightrope walk. 🚶‍♀️
